Guest swollenballs Posted December 31, 2009 Report Posted December 31, 2009 Hey all, i was just wondering if anyone knows the setting for Tom Tom Navigator. At the moment it is saying no GPS device even though I've set it to "internal GPS". I've also tried to set the GPS deivce as "other NMEA GPS reciever" but it keps saying no GPS device". After setting these the phones says it must restart but the GPS is never detected by TTN7 Is TTN7 definately compatible with TG01? Few other settings its asking me is the: GPS baud rate, com port. I kept these as the default. Does anyone know whats wrong? Any help appreciated.

I amrunning it fine on my TG01 I installed GPSGate 2.6 and selected the defaults - Virtual COM2 In TomTom 7 I have it Configured as Other NMEA GPS Reciever GPS Baud Rate 57600 and the Franson COM2 should be selected to match you Virtual COM2 set in GPSGate It was not detecting on the GPS reciever on mine so I had to use GPSGate
Guest Neil5459 Posted January 2, 2010 Report Posted January 2, 2010 TomTom's software is unable to detect a GPS signal on the GPD ports (basically down to bad programming!) To run TomTom you do need to find an intermediary program which will locate the port then forward it to TomTom. As segaboys says, Franson GPSGate can do this, but it is not free. There is another 'intermediary' program Here on XDA Developers, but I don't know if it would work on the TG01- might be worth a question in the thread?

I tried version 1.38 and 1.39 (internationnal) but it does not work... I also tried PortSplitter and GPSPlex. Only GPSPlex works and is freeware. Get it here : http://www.maicas.net/gpsplex (Spanish website). Tutorial (in French) with screenshots (so you should be able to get things done even if you don't speak French or Spanish) : http://toshiba-tg01.forumactif.com/tuto-f6...tomtom-t334.htm But I will try again GPS MOd Driver when I find enough time to do it carefully. I can assign GPS Mod Driver port in TT7 but no signal (and works great under many other GPS software). Edited January 4, 2010 by The Real Mc Coy
